What are the key advantages of buying a pharmacy in the Highlands and Islands
• Strong Community Ties: The Highlands and Islands are home to close-knit communities that rely heavily on local businesses. Owning a pharmacy in these areas provides an opportunity to build deep connections with customers and become an integral part of community healthcare.
• Government Support and Funding: The Scottish government offers various funding opportunities and grants to support businesses in rural areas. Pharmacies in the Highlands and Islands may benefit from specific rural development incentives that help with operating costs and expansion.
• Limited Competition: The more remote nature of the Highlands and Islands means fewer pharmacies in many areas, reducing competition. This can offer a significant opportunity for growth, as established businesses become essential to the community and can build strong, loyal customer relationships.
What are the key financial considerations when purchasing a pharmacy?
• The price of the pharmacy can vary significantly based on location, size, profitability, and stock levels.
• Consider ongoing costs like staffing, inventory, insurance, and utility bills.
• Understand how the pharmacy generates income, including NHS services, private sales, and private prescriptions.

Where do I learn more about the current operations of a pharmacy before purchasing?
Your solicitor should provide a due diligence questionnaire, which will ask about the business, employees, property, operations, insurance, and financial matters.
What key aspects of the Financial Health of the business should I consider when acquiring a pharmacy?
• Profitability: Review the pharmacy’s financial statements, including income, expenses, and profit margins.
• Revenue streams: Understand the income sources, such as NHS prescriptions, private sales, and over-the-counter products.
• Cash flow: Assess the pharmacy’s ability to generate consistent cash flow to cover expenses and reinvest in the business.
• Debts and liabilities: Check for any outstanding debts, loans, or financial obligations that could affect the business.
